“I did not feel 'evil' when I wrote advertisements for Puerto Rico. They helped attract industry and tourists to a country which had been living on the edge of starvation for 400 years.”

David Ogilvy

About This Quote

Source Book: Confessions of an Advertising Man, 1963

He justified promoting Puerto Rico despite moral concerns because it spurred economic relief for a starving population.

In simple terms: He saw ads as a tool to help a poor region.
